While using oven I heard a pop sound come from top control area. Panel started to beep and showed f1 on display. Cleared with clear off button but within seconds f1 and beeping started again. Could not get any control buttons to work. Do I need to change the whole control board? There does not appear to be any burnt looking areas on back of control board. Also did not smell like anything burnt.
For model number PFEF375CS
Hello Holly, Thank you for the question. This woudl indicate the Electronic Control Board, PartSelect Number PS444421 has shorted out and will need to be replaced. I looked up the part and it is listed as No Longer Available/Discontinued. There are no part substitutions listed. My suggestion here would be to call the manufacturer and see if they can provide you with a substitution for these part numbers. Hope this helps!
